Bug#1095007: ITP: litestar-htmx -- HTMX Integration for Litestar
Package: wnpp
Severity: wishlist
Owner: Carsten Schoenert <c.schoenert@t-online.de>
X-Debbugs-Cc: debian-devel@lists.debian.org
* Package name : litestar-htmx
Version : 0.4.1
Upstream Contact: Litestar Developers <hello@litestar.dev>
* URL : https://github.com/litestar-org/litestar-htmx
* License : MIT/X
Programming Lang: Python
Description : HTMX Integration for Litestar
The Litestar framework supports Plugins, ships with dependency injection,
security primitives, OpenAPI schema generation, MessagePack, middlewares, a
great CLI experience, and much more.
.
HTMX is a JavaScript library that gives you access to AJAX, CSS
Transitions, WebSockets and Server Sent Events directly in HTML, using
attributes, so you can build modern user interfaces with the simplicity and
power of hypertext.
.
This package provides Python bindings for the Litestar package to interact
with the HTMX functionalities.
The Litestar package isn't packaged and available in the archiv yet.
litstar-htmx is an AddOn for the Litestar ASGI framework and for now a
dependency to get the test suite of Litestar running. But Litestar later
will also require this AddOn for ffull funxtionality.
Litestar is needed for test suite of strawberry-graphql (to be packaged
later).
This package strawberry-graphql is a dependency for
strawberry-graphql-django that is then a dependency for NetBox >= 4.x.
I plan to maintain this package within the DPT.
Regards
Carsten
Reply to: